Mod 110, Unit 3 Terminology

AB
Americans with Disabilities ActLegislation to protect the rights of the disabled regarding access to employment, public buildings, transportation, housing, schools and health care facilities.
VendorsSuppliers if equpment used in the medical office
Receptionistperson greeting patients and answering telephones, but job responsibilities can also extend to organizing, updating and filing medical records both on paper and electronically.
Co-paymentssmall fees that patient are responible for paying at the time of service
CollatingPulling and organizing data (ie. test results, medical records, etc.)
Sign-inA form that patients sign when they arrive for their appointments
Demographicpatient data such as name, address, telephone number, age, gender, ethnic background, place of employment etc.
No ShowsA(n) patient or employee that does not show up as scheduled and does not notify the office.
Specified time schedulingTime allocated to each patient is dependent upon reason for the visit.
Cycle timeThe length of time the average the patient spends in the medical office
Wave schedulingscheduling a number of patients at one time (hence, a “wave”) and none in the succeeding time slots, in the expectation that visits will average out in time usage.
Modified wave schedulingScheduling 2-3 patients within the hour, and patients would be seen during the entire hour block
Double-bookingThe practice of scheduling two patients to be seen during the same time slot without allowing for any additional time in the schedule
Archivecollection of records of or about an institution, family, etc 2. a place where such records are kept
Tickler Filecard filing system divided by dates to remind of future events
Patient referralsWhen patients are referred to another facility or physician for further testing and treatment.
Surgical schedulerthe person in the surgery department who schedules the procedures
New patientpatient being seen for the first time in the office
Established patientpatient who has a history of seeing the physician
Advanced bookingfuture appointments
Time patternsCatch up time or non-scheduled appointments
Manual Systemhard copy schedule book
